What if lakes and rivers had the same rights as humans?

DECEMBER 23, 2020NEW ON TED.COM
Why lakes and rivers should have the same rights as humans · TED Women 2019Water is essential to life. Yet in the eyes of the law, it remains largely unprotected — leaving many communities without access to safe drinking water, says legal scholar Kelsey Leonard. In this powerful talk, she shows why granting lakes and rivers legal “personhood” — giving them the same legal rights as humans — is the first step to protecting our bodies of water and fundamentally transforming how we value this vital resource.
